Robertson Stephens Advisors's Q3 2017 Portfolio in Review
As of Q3 2017, Robertson Stephens Advisors held 75 positions worth $116M, up 4.2% from $111M the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 54% of the portfolio.
Robertson Stephens Advisors's Q3 2017 filing shows 3 new, 19 increased, 33 reduced and 10 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Fidelity MSCI Health Care Index ETF: 15,149 shares worth $599K. The largest sale was iShares Currency Hedged MSCI Eurozone ETF, an estimated $5.77M.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 1.5% of assets, down from 1.8%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Healthcare.
